Struct OptionalArcParkingRwLockKeyPathChain 

Source
pub struct OptionalArcParkingRwLockKeyPathChain<Root, InnerValue, SubValue, F, G>
where F: for<'r> Fn(&'r Root) -> Option<&'r Arc<RwLock<RawRwLock, InnerValue>>>, G: for<'r> Fn(&'r InnerValue) -> &'r SubValue,
{ /* private fields */ }
Expand description

A composed keypath chain from optional keypath through Arc<parking_lot::RwLock> - functional style

Implementations§

Source§

impl<Root, InnerValue, SubValue, F, G> OptionalArcParkingRwLockKeyPathChain<Root, InnerValue, SubValue, F, G>
where F: for<'r> Fn(&'r Root) -> Option<&'r Arc<RwLock<RawRwLock, InnerValue>>>, G: for<'r> Fn(&'r InnerValue) -> &'r SubValue,

Source

pub fn get<Callback>(self, container: &Root, callback: Callback) -> Option<()>
where Callback: FnOnce(&SubValue),

Apply the composed keypath chain to a container (read lock)

Source

pub fn then<NextValue, H>( self, next: KeyPath<SubValue, NextValue, H>, ) -> OptionalArcParkingRwLockKeyPathChain<Root, InnerValue, NextValue, F, impl for<'r> Fn(&'r InnerValue) + 'static>
where H: for<'r> Fn(&'r SubValue) -> &'r NextValue + 'static, G: 'static, InnerValue: 'static, SubValue: 'static, NextValue: 'static,

Chain with another readable keypath through another level

Source

pub fn chain_optional<NextValue, H>( self, next: OptionalKeyPath<SubValue, NextValue, H>, ) -> OptionalArcParkingRwLockOptionalKeyPathChain<Root, InnerValue, NextValue, F, impl for<'r> Fn(&'r InnerValue) + 'static>
where H: for<'r> Fn(&'r SubValue) -> Option<&'r NextValue> + 'static, G: 'static, InnerValue: 'static, SubValue: 'static, NextValue: 'static,

Chain with an optional readable keypath through another level
